What is a Construction Monthly Report Template?
A Construction Monthly Report Template is a standardized document used by construction professionals to summarize project progress, funding, and resources over a month. This template typically includes sections for project descriptions, safety reports, financial forecasts, and any noteworthy changes or challenges faced during the reporting period. Utilizing such templates ensures consistency, accuracy, and straightforward communication among stakeholders.
Why you might need to create a Construction Monthly Report Template
Organizations need a Construction Monthly Report Template for several reasons:
-
1.To maintain project transparency for stakeholders, including investors, clients, and project managers.
-
2.To streamline the reporting process, saving time and reducing the likelihood of errors.
-
3.To provide a clear overview of project activities, enhancing accountability and decision-making.
-
4.To facilitate compliance with contractual obligations and regulatory frameworks.

Typical use-cases and sectors that often utilize a Construction Monthly Report Template
The Construction Monthly Report Template serves numerous sectors and use-cases, including:
-
1.General Contractors to summarize ongoing project progress.
-
2.Architectural Firms needing to communicate changes and timelines to clients.
-
3.Project Managers for internal reviews of team performance and resource allocation.
-
4.Construction Owners to review overall project health and budget adherence.
